Cheesy Ham Breakfast Rolls
Ingredients
For the dough (or use ready-made puff pastry):
- 1 sheet puff pastry or pizza dough
For the filling:
- 200 g grated cheese (Cheddar, mozzarella, or a mix)
- 150 g cooked ham, diced
- 2 spring onions, sliced (optional)
- 2 eggs
- 100 ml milk or cream
- Salt and black pepper
Method
- Preheat the oven to 190°C (170°C fan).
- Line a baking tin with the pastry.
- Mix the ham, cheese, spring onions, eggs, and milk.
- Season with pepper (and a little salt if needed).
- Pour the filling onto the pastry.
- Bake for 30–40 minutes, until golden and set.
- Cool slightly before slicing.
It keeps well in the refrigerator for 3–4 days and can be eaten cold or reheated for breakfast or as a snack.
